The cutoff marks for Sir Visvesvaraya Institute of Technology (SVIT), Nashik, for B.E./B.Tech admissions via MHT CET 2024 vary by course and category. For General category : for Computer Engineering, expect ~80-85 percentile (Rank: ~15,000–20,000); Information Technology: ~75-80 percentile (Rank: ~20,000–25,000); Chemical and Mechanical Engineering: ~45-60 percentile (Rank: ~40,000–60,000). JEE Main 2024 cutoffs for Sir Visvesvaraya Institute of Technology, Nashik (All India Quota, last round): B.E. in Information Technology - General: 192415 (closing rank); other branches (e.g., Chemical, Mechanical, Electronics & Telecom) - General: 192415–388882 (closing ranks). Category-wise cutoffs (OBC/SC/ST/EWS) are not specified. Qualifying cutoffs for JEE Advanced 2024: General: 93.23 percentile, OBC: 79.67, EWS: 81.32, SC: 60.09, ST: 46.69.

To get a seat in MITE - Mangalore Institute of Technology and Engineering for B.E. in Computer Science and Engineering, follow these steps:
1. Appear for Common Entrance Test (CET) conducted by the Government of Karnataka or COMED-K.
2. Check the eligibility and selection criteria, which is based on the rank obtained in the entrance test.
3. Apply for admission to MITE, ensuring you meet the required criteria.
4. 45% of the seats are filled through CET and 30% through COMED-K.
Note: The admission process and seat allocation are subject to the rules and regulations set by the Government of Karnataka.

For admission to BE in Computer Engineering at DY Patil Institute of Technology Pune, the 60% eligibility requirement can be exempted for c&idates who have passed Diploma in Engineering & Technology with at least 45% marks, or B.Sc. Degree from a recognised University with at least 45% marks. Additionally, c&idates belonging to backward class categories & Persons with Disability in Maharashtra State may be eligible with 40% marks.
